Proponents off automobile label financing state these lenders suffice an essential objective by giving quick-name emergency money to those who require to handle an immediate economic crisis. They applaud the brand new CFPB’s decision so you’re able to decelerate the underwriting code.
Town Financial payday loans in Missouri Attributes Association regarding The united states, and therefore represents loads of people on nonbank brief-title financing globe (known as the brand new pay day credit business), claims bodies is always to run approaching illegal mortgage whales in lieu of the newest quick-term financing field. Over-controls do force short-term lenders to go out of organization and leave consumers vulnerable to help you harmful, unlawful choices, they state.
An excellent libertarian think-tank, the newest Aggressive Business Institute, contends your underwriting requirement will make it much harder for economically upset borrowers to obtain the quick cash they require.
“However it is perhaps not easy money in the event it will get a pattern off unaffordable loans,” says Suzanne Martindale, senior plan guidance at User Accounts. “These lenders pick up storefronts in underserved organizations. They actually do competitive Google and Twitter advertisements, radio, Television, any is required to allow you to get regarding door. But when they turn you into start borrowing from the bank, they’re going to make a good looking money if they produce stuck for the a longer period out-of personal debt.”
Businesses giving fund that have straight down (two-digit) APRs and you can fees do exists regarding brief-title financing world, Martindale states. But as these organizations features less information than the around three-thumb lenders to invest in revenue and appearance optimization, “when you attend Google and type in ‘score a beneficial $a thousand mortgage,’ its content will not appear.”
Ideas on how to Manage On your own
The best way to stop trouble when you have a money-move disaster should be to plan the possibility. Extremely fiscal experts suggest having an urgent situation loans with sufficient money to pay for three to six months of expenditures. One method to help financing you to definitely membership would be to examine their monthly obligations to see the place you you are going to thin expenditures. Perhaps there are cellular phone or cable functions you could quit.
A different way to prepare to own an economic crisis would be to sign-up a card connection that gives reasonable pay-day possibilities, McClary indicates. Some borrowing from the bank unions need you to register thanks to a chapel, a manager, otherwise a community class. To join, you order a portion to own $5 in order to $twenty five. Borrowing unions may also charge a nominal commission to open up their savings account. This new National Borrowing Commitment Administration provides a card union locator and you may brings detailed information on precisely how to signup.
Signing up for a lending community is an additional alternative. Talking about groups you to definitely remind you to definitely conserve and you may boost your number of financial balances. After you join a credit network, you have to pay a quantity, like $fifty otherwise $100 a month, to the a container of cash which you can use to include interest-100 % free fund so you can members of the newest system. Brand new Objective Investment Funds is a great nonprofit providers which will help your register a circle. “Credit groups try a significant money, and something that aided many people,” McClary says.

But if you have no socked-out deals and you’re not into the a credit commitment otherwise lending system, you have still got choices that are better than getting an automobile identity mortgage when you require money easily.
Such, if you’re a member of the brand new military or an experienced founded, you can aquire an initial-identity emergency mortgage having zero % desire away from an army save team such as for instance Military Emergency Save, the latest Navy-Aquatic Corps Save Society, additionally the Air Push Assistance People. All of the branch of the military have one, McClary says.
